summaryrefslogtreecommitdiff
path: root/dev-php
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-12-24 08:01:36 +0000
committerV3n3RiX <venerix@koprulu.sector>2022-12-24 08:01:36 +0000
commit1cf3f23200484257eaf7d863e323e7e9aee98d2b (patch)
tree90c6263d1ca4d504601d8df05db598f5737b07ce /dev-php
parent4583148f2657a7a66fd68b25c9fab02be110c989 (diff)
gentoo auto-resync : 24:12:2022 - 08:01:36
Diffstat (limited to 'dev-php')
-rw-r--r--dev-php/Manifest.gzbin38398 -> 38397 bytes
-rw-r--r--dev-php/libvirt-php/Manifest4
-rw-r--r--dev-php/libvirt-php/libvirt-php-0.5.7.ebuild71
-rw-r--r--dev-php/libvirt-php/libvirt-php-9999.ebuild3
4 files changed, 74 insertions, 4 deletions
diff --git a/dev-php/Manifest.gz b/dev-php/Manifest.gz
index 8772df9ee4dd..87cc8a0f3174 100644
--- a/dev-php/Manifest.gz
+++ b/dev-php/Manifest.gz
Binary files differ
diff --git a/dev-php/libvirt-php/Manifest b/dev-php/libvirt-php/Manifest
index 9d7f12fe635e..2cb6080478f3 100644
--- a/dev-php/libvirt-php/Manifest
+++ b/dev-php/libvirt-php/Manifest
@@ -1,5 +1,7 @@
AUX remove-imagick-check.patch 331 BLAKE2B 2d9c164055c3f54baf259326abe22d5aa478141df7f6ea05ba33f040701947038490c1898e89a7019cc1e41008fde5cb43c338730ef7ec3020f5005edd612d9c SHA512 1e949f8c704a2e6b541a276b8cb53e9cf09f009dadc01f4f50ad02e92258cfe30130b2d22b811e0b5b07e1bad4023fad05040c6031bd0063999212c2d6483bcf
DIST libvirt-php-0.5.6.tar.xz 386372 BLAKE2B 30d6a1c8dd18a4bd9d46e9c20551978fa0c20f2d671a359fdbf86def5166df7f882e65c509087efe0acef7d0dc468b3eb520689f9e7ba552e966809c8f647390 SHA512 5d1b3a2afc697051a5a0d4750ce4d02b31f482b1c17ef2cf4a593b705de438d8ccb4b1543ce6b2520b450734b3634e64ccf9200227f5681cbd2daad5a9f5ee9c
+DIST libvirt-php-0.5.7.tar.xz 389380 BLAKE2B c8189ffdeb29a056ef959624cd46a18ce7e4e00df6a42bfb3d6349ee8aa3865a4d66b82aed9ee4f68aa7f9761adb8eb8b62bd15d7c6e8e17c187ae44eba71a86 SHA512 ecc640ce2c936f59824212eca36bbe3ae13c560854e0d86da9f1d4d02373751f974b374915ded57d74636c0443c09c895857e8701204fbf49c402c1f315ae0b7
EBUILD libvirt-php-0.5.6.ebuild 1453 BLAKE2B 2d30fa5fe60d8015ad498cbd6368c059e0fc4f8345a0d56a17ce31de99d4f3ef5f4e659b085f51d5ebdb72854c5f7b72d7cc55c87a0f45c796857f882a1d7d96 SHA512 54aef6536f38ffdded99ee8fa4f5982adab87e88f68e8bbd57aa8ea3e7af68732d3431331433f3ac6bf3ab1d97b1e08aa6a794d1550413b49feb305aafa125f0
-EBUILD libvirt-php-9999.ebuild 1463 BLAKE2B d482021104136ac237690ed9ffec6ffde66d54fd8adec41d3c2e6caf68ff0bcde507f6792d27ea6727eb6279d0dc7fc972a3021157872d5cff02ddb391649395 SHA512 8d982f4c805b5a485c6a12cbb1604d5c6a9041c1b594dc74c3577ea217b567325ec034673362bb46381793e8fb918d116ecb2095aa78d293f62120d7328ec57f
+EBUILD libvirt-php-0.5.7.ebuild 1288 BLAKE2B 28207036727113dd72ab1bdd43d5dbc49c420a196a81cdcf5504a582c606966fd3f8dc072c276acd634fcc702946334e918ab51d41b18b4b6f30962ec0abf747 SHA512 f9b4ec150e0fec95306aa19daecf808ad918df085c5d9151fa5caa919d177a59b344bbe41dc22190179840b98d49374a86b5338b3d471de3b0c8a4195f75c07e
+EBUILD libvirt-php-9999.ebuild 1298 BLAKE2B dd47a71214d22c05944114168975a05ffcea4b4399141991ad3c14b4b0af2cfcd825d530bf3ca56414b86e824865943f59267deaac7dd9087ee103913b9ecd4e SHA512 8bc659879969f65acfb147ad3650cf41f4f85e328f211e038b7b1d3ef404cfd9ff2b305c9d3820b9f975907dc542d23790293ace942c7bd4bb634c58bd14b0e2
MISC metadata.xml 456 BLAKE2B 845b0f2472da5b862a46a3ac26fdabe28229a0b6b190fdc293741732e36eaaa00efed4678b0ae06b3c0692ad4315240efb2050914a23c831a368e9c6e4589271 SHA512 b16080b8879f9db4e459214842b483c06aff8feedf9aa72785b1924225088e3ea58afb15afdd46334beb299c29db59a68308f5fec1ab26b5e62b8faff6b4f78a
diff --git a/dev-php/libvirt-php/libvirt-php-0.5.7.ebuild b/dev-php/libvirt-php/libvirt-php-0.5.7.ebuild
new file mode 100644
index 000000000000..96777d784f67
--- /dev/null
+++ b/dev-php/libvirt-php/libvirt-php-0.5.7.ebuild
@@ -0,0 +1,71 @@
+# Copyright 1999-2022 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I="8"
+
+PHP_EXT_NAME="libvirt-php"
+PHP_EXT_SKIP_PHPIZE="yes"
+USE_PHP="php7-4 php8-0 php8-1"
+PHP_EXT_ECONF_ARGS=()
+
+inherit php-ext-source-r3 autotools
+
+DESCRIPTION="PHP bindings for libvirt"
+HOMEPAGE="http://libvirt.org/php/"
+SRC_URI="http://libvirt.org/sources/php/${P}.tar.xz"
+
+LICENSE="LGPL-2.1"
+SLOT="0"
+KEYWORDS="~amd64"
+IUSE="doc"
+
+RDEPEND="app-emulation/libvirt
+ dev-libs/libxml2"
+DEPEND="${RDEPEND}
+ dev-libs/libxslt
+ virtual/pkgconfig
+ doc? ( app-text/xhtml1 )"
+
+DOCS=( ChangeLog NEWS README )
+
+src_unpack() {
+ default
+
+ # create the default modules directory to be able
+ # to use the php-ext-source-r3 eclass to configure/build
+ ln -s src "${S}/modules" || die
+}
+
+src_prepare() {
+ php-ext-source-r3_src_prepare
+
+ local slot
+ for slot in $(php_get_slots); do
+ php_init_slot_env "${slot}"
+ eautoreconf
+ done
+}
+
+src_install() {
+ local slot
+ for slot in $(php_get_slots); do
+ php_init_slot_env ${slot}
+ insinto "${EXT_DIR}"
+ doins "src/.libs/${PHP_EXT_NAME}.so"
+ done
+
+ php-ext-source-r3_createinifiles
+ einstalldocs
+
+ if use doc ; then
+ docinto html
+ dodoc -r docs/*
+ fi
+}
+
+src_test() {
+ for slot in $(php_get_slots); do
+ php_init_slot_env ${slot}
+ default
+ done
+}
diff --git a/dev-php/libvirt-php/libvirt-php-9999.ebuild b/dev-php/libvirt-php/libvirt-php-9999.ebuild
index df851fcfe3a0..8dd8a850a9ca 100644
--- a/dev-php/libvirt-php/libvirt-php-9999.ebuild
+++ b/dev-php/libvirt-php/libvirt-php-9999.ebuild
@@ -27,9 +27,6 @@ DEPEND="${RDEPEND}
doc? ( app-text/xhtml1 )"
DOCS=( ChangeLog NEWS README )
-# Remove the insane check for pecl-imagick which is only used in examples
-# and is not called upon in any build
-PATCHES=( "${FILESDIR}/remove-imagick-check.patch" )
src_unpack() {
git-r3_src_unpack